WebThis chapter focuses on the Self-Glorification Hymn from Qumran, which is among the many writings of the community that had withdrawn from Jerusalem to the Dead Sea and … WebSep 20, 2013 · The text termed the “Self-Glorification Hymn” appears to depict a human author who claims to have been exalted above the angels and allowed to sit on a throne in heaven in the council of the gods. Furthermore, the “secondary prince” of the highest heaven, the chief of all angels, is often seen as an exalted human.

WebThe hymn goes on to speak of a shoot (to, i£n) nourished by the streams. Isaiah speaks of the Servant as a sapling and a shoot (pur, ahtf)· The terminology is different, but in 16: 10 we are told that the one who causes this shoot to grow is hidden, without esteem (atfm ki d) like the Servant in Isa 53:3.
